FRX SDK Documentation 2025 SP0
Loading...
Searching...
No Matches
Public Types | Public Member Functions | List of all members
AcDbDxfFiler Class Reference

#include <AcDbDxfFiler.h>

Inheritance diagram for AcDbDxfFiler:
AcRxObject AcRTTIObject AcObject

Public Types

enum  { kDfltPrec = -1 , kMaxPrec = 16 }
 

Public Member Functions

 ACRX_DECLARE_MEMBERS (AcDbDxfFiler)
 
 AcDbDxfFiler (void)
 
AcDbFilerControllercontroller (void) const
 
virtual ~AcDbDxfFiler (void)
 
virtual bool atEOF (void)
 
virtual bool atEmbeddedObjectStart (void)
 
virtual bool atEndOfObject (void)
 
virtual bool atExtendedData (void)
 
virtual bool atSubclassData (wchar_t const *)
 
virtual bool isModifyingExistingObject (void) const
 
virtual double elevation (void) const
 
virtual double thickness (void) const
 
virtual Acad::ErrorStatus __cdecl setError (Acad::ErrorStatus, wchar_t const *,...)
 
virtual Acad::ErrorStatus __cdecl setError (wchar_t const *,...)
 
virtual Acad::ErrorStatus dwgVersion (AcDb::AcDbDwgVersion &, AcDb::MaintenanceReleaseVersion &) const
 
virtual Acad::ErrorStatus pushBackItem (void)
 
virtual Acad::ErrorStatus readResBuf (resbuf *)
 
virtual Acad::ErrorStatus writeEmbeddedObjectStart (void)
 
virtual Acad::ErrorStatus writeResBuf (resbuf const &)
 
virtual Acad::ErrorStatus writeXDataStart (void)
 
virtual int precision (void) const
 
virtual void haltAtClassBoundries (bool)
 
virtual void setPrecision (int)
 
virtual wchar_t const * errorMessage (void) const
 
virtual Acad::ErrorStatus readItem (resbuf *)
 
virtual Acad::ErrorStatus writeItem (int, ACHAR const *)
 
virtual Acad::ErrorStatus writeItem (int, AcDbObjectId const &)
 
virtual Acad::ErrorStatus writeItem (int, int)
 
virtual Acad::ErrorStatus writeItem (int, AcDbHardPointerId const &)
 
virtual Acad::ErrorStatus writeItem (int, unsigned long)
 
virtual Acad::ErrorStatus writeItem (int, ads_binary const &)
 
virtual Acad::ErrorStatus writeInt16 (int, Adesk::Int16 const &)
 
virtual Acad::ErrorStatus writeUInt32 (int, Adesk::UInt32 const &)
 
virtual Acad::ErrorStatus writeUInt64 (int, Adesk::UInt64 const &)
 
virtual Acad::ErrorStatus writeInt64 (int, Adesk::Int64 const &)
 
virtual Acad::ErrorStatus writePoint2d (int, const AcGePoint2d &, int=-1)
 
virtual Acad::ErrorStatus writePoint3d (int, const AcGePoint3d &, int=-1)
 
virtual Acad::ErrorStatus writeVector2d (int, const AcGeVector2d &, int=-1)
 
virtual Acad::ErrorStatus writeVector3d (int, const AcGeVector3d &, int=-1)
 
virtual Acad::ErrorStatus writeScale3d (int, const AcGeScale3d &, int=-1)
 
virtual Acad::ErrorStatus writeString (int, ACHAR const *)
 
virtual Acad::ErrorStatus writeInt32 (int, long)
 
virtual Acad::ErrorStatus writeDouble (int, double, int=-1)
 
virtual Acad::ErrorStatus writeItem (int, AcGePoint2d const &, int=-1)
 
virtual Acad::ErrorStatus writeItem (int, AcGePoint3d const &, int=-1)
 
virtual Acad::ErrorStatus writeItem (int, AcGeVector2d const &, int=-1)
 
virtual Acad::ErrorStatus writeItem (int, AcGeVector3d const &, int=-1)
 
virtual Acad::ErrorStatus writeItem (int, AcGeScale3d const &, int=-1)
 
virtual int rewindFiler ()
 
virtual Acad::ErrorStatus filerStatus () const
 
virtual void resetFilerStatus ()
 
virtual AcDb::FilerType filerType () const
 
virtual AcDbDatabasedatabase () const
 
virtual Acad::ErrorStatus extendedDwgMaintenanceReleaseVersion (AcDb::MaintenanceReleaseVersion &) const
 
virtual Acad::ErrorStatus writeObjectId (int, const AcDbObjectId &)
 
virtual Acad::ErrorStatus writeInt8 (int, Adesk::Int8)
 
virtual Acad::ErrorStatus writeString (int, const AcString &)
 
virtual Acad::ErrorStatus writeBChunk (int, const ads_binary &)
 
virtual Acad::ErrorStatus writeAcDbHandle (int, const AcDbHandle &)
 
virtual Acad::ErrorStatus writeUInt16 (int, Adesk::UInt16)
 
virtual Acad::ErrorStatus writeUInt8 (int, Adesk::UInt8)
 
virtual Acad::ErrorStatus writeBoolean (int, Adesk::Boolean)
 
virtual Acad::ErrorStatus writeBool (int, bool)
 
virtual bool includesDefaultValues () const
 
virtual void haltAtClassBoundaries (bool)
 
Acad::ErrorStatus writeItem (const resbuf &)
 
Acad::ErrorStatus writeItem (int, const AcString &)
 
Acad::ErrorStatus writeItem (int, const AcDbHandle &)
 
Acad::ErrorStatus writeItem (int, Adesk::Int32)
 
Acad::ErrorStatus writeItem (int, Adesk::Int8)
 
Acad::ErrorStatus writeItem (int, Adesk::UInt16)
 
Acad::ErrorStatus writeItem (int, Adesk::UInt8)
 
Acad::ErrorStatus writeItem (int, bool)
 
Acad::ErrorStatus writeItem (int, double, int=-1)
 
- Public Member Functions inherited from AcRxObject
virtual AcRxObjectqueryX (AcRxClass const *) const
 
AcRxObjectx (AcRxClass const *) const
 
virtual AcRxClassisA (void) const
 
virtual AcRxObjectclone (void) const
 
virtual AcRx::Ordering comparedTo (AcRxObject const *) const
 
virtual Acad::ErrorStatus copyFrom (AcRxObject const *)
 
virtual int isEqualTo (AcRxObject const *) const
 
bool isKindOf (const AcRxClass *pOtherClass) const
 
virtual ~AcRxObject (void)
 
- Public Member Functions inherited from AcRTTIObject
 AcRTTIObject ()
 
virtual ~AcRTTIObject ()
 
- Public Member Functions inherited from AcObject
 AcObject ()
 
 AcObject (const AcObject &source)
 
virtual ~AcObject ()
 
voiddata () const
 

Additional Inherited Members

- Static Public Member Functions inherited from AcRxObject
static AcRxClass *__cdecl desc (void)
 
static AcRxObject *__cdecl cast (AcRxObject const *)
 
- Protected Member Functions inherited from AcRxObject
 AcRxObject (void)
 
virtual AcRxObjectsubQueryX (AcRxClass const *) const
 
- Protected Attributes inherited from AcObject
voidm_pData
 

Detailed Description

Definition at line 27 of file AcDbDxfFiler.h.

Member Enumeration Documentation

◆ anonymous enum

Enumerator
kDfltPrec 
kMaxPrec 

Definition at line 31 of file AcDbDxfFiler.h.

Constructor & Destructor Documentation

◆ AcDbDxfFiler()

AcDbDxfFiler::AcDbDxfFiler ( void )

◆ ~AcDbDxfFiler()

virtual AcDbDxfFiler::~AcDbDxfFiler ( void )
virtual

Member Function Documentation

◆ ACRX_DECLARE_MEMBERS()

AcDbDxfFiler::ACRX_DECLARE_MEMBERS ( AcDbDxfFiler )

◆ atEmbeddedObjectStart()

virtual bool AcDbDxfFiler::atEmbeddedObjectStart ( void )
virtual

◆ atEndOfObject()

virtual bool AcDbDxfFiler::atEndOfObject ( void )
virtual

◆ atEOF()

virtual bool AcDbDxfFiler::atEOF ( void )
virtual

◆ atExtendedData()

virtual bool AcDbDxfFiler::atExtendedData ( void )
virtual

◆ atSubclassData()

virtual bool AcDbDxfFiler::atSubclassData ( wchar_t const * )
virtual

◆ controller()

AcDbFilerController & AcDbDxfFiler::controller ( void ) const

◆ database()

virtual AcDbDatabase * AcDbDxfFiler::database ( ) const
virtual

◆ dwgVersion()

virtual Acad::ErrorStatus AcDbDxfFiler::dwgVersion ( AcDb::AcDbDwgVersion & ,
AcDb::MaintenanceReleaseVersion &  ) const
virtual

◆ elevation()

virtual double AcDbDxfFiler::elevation ( void ) const
virtual

◆ errorMessage()

virtual wchar_t const * AcDbDxfFiler::errorMessage ( void ) const
virtual

◆ extendedDwgMaintenanceReleaseVersion()

virtual Acad::ErrorStatus AcDbDxfFiler::extendedDwgMaintenanceReleaseVersion ( AcDb::MaintenanceReleaseVersion & ) const
virtual

◆ filerStatus()

virtual Acad::ErrorStatus AcDbDxfFiler::filerStatus ( ) const
virtual

◆ filerType()

virtual AcDb::FilerType AcDbDxfFiler::filerType ( ) const
virtual

◆ haltAtClassBoundaries()

virtual void AcDbDxfFiler::haltAtClassBoundaries ( bool )
virtual

◆ haltAtClassBoundries()

virtual void AcDbDxfFiler::haltAtClassBoundries ( bool )
virtual

◆ includesDefaultValues()

virtual bool AcDbDxfFiler::includesDefaultValues ( ) const
virtual

◆ isModifyingExistingObject()

virtual bool AcDbDxfFiler::isModifyingExistingObject ( void ) const
virtual

◆ precision()

virtual int AcDbDxfFiler::precision ( void ) const
virtual

◆ pushBackItem()

virtual Acad::ErrorStatus AcDbDxfFiler::pushBackItem ( void )
virtual

◆ readItem()

virtual Acad::ErrorStatus AcDbDxfFiler::readItem ( resbuf * )
virtual

◆ readResBuf()

virtual Acad::ErrorStatus AcDbDxfFiler::readResBuf ( resbuf * )
virtual

◆ resetFilerStatus()

virtual void AcDbDxfFiler::resetFilerStatus ( )
virtual

◆ rewindFiler()

virtual int AcDbDxfFiler::rewindFiler ( )
virtual

◆ setError() [1/2]

virtual Acad::ErrorStatus __cdecl AcDbDxfFiler::setError ( Acad::ErrorStatus ,
wchar_t const * ,
... )
virtual

◆ setError() [2/2]

virtual Acad::ErrorStatus __cdecl AcDbDxfFiler::setError ( wchar_t const * ,
... )
virtual

◆ setPrecision()

virtual void AcDbDxfFiler::setPrecision ( int )
virtual

◆ thickness()

virtual double AcDbDxfFiler::thickness ( void ) const
virtual

◆ writeAcDbHandle()

virtual Acad::ErrorStatus AcDbDxfFiler::writeAcDbHandle ( int ,
const AcDbHandle &  )
virtual

◆ writeBChunk()

virtual Acad::ErrorStatus AcDbDxfFiler::writeBChunk ( int ,
const ads_binary &  )
virtual

◆ writeBool()

virtual Acad::ErrorStatus AcDbDxfFiler::writeBool ( int ,
bool  )
virtual

◆ writeBoolean()

virtual Acad::ErrorStatus AcDbDxfFiler::writeBoolean ( int ,
Adesk::Boolean  )
virtual

◆ writeDouble()

virtual Acad::ErrorStatus AcDbDxfFiler::writeDouble ( int ,
double ,
int = -1 )
virtual

◆ writeEmbeddedObjectStart()

virtual Acad::ErrorStatus AcDbDxfFiler::writeEmbeddedObjectStart ( void )
virtual

◆ writeInt16()

virtual Acad::ErrorStatus AcDbDxfFiler::writeInt16 ( int ,
Adesk::Int16 const &  )
virtual

◆ writeInt32()

virtual Acad::ErrorStatus AcDbDxfFiler::writeInt32 ( int ,
long  )
virtual

◆ writeInt64()

virtual Acad::ErrorStatus AcDbDxfFiler::writeInt64 ( int ,
Adesk::Int64 const &  )
virtual

◆ writeInt8()

virtual Acad::ErrorStatus AcDbDxfFiler::writeInt8 ( int ,
Adesk::Int8  )
virtual

◆ writeItem() [1/20]

Acad::ErrorStatus AcDbDxfFiler::writeItem ( const resbuf & )

◆ writeItem() [2/20]

virtual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
AcDbHardPointerId const &  )
virtual

◆ writeItem() [3/20]

virtual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
AcDbObjectId const &  )
virtual

◆ writeItem() [4/20]

virtual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
AcGePoint2d const & ,
int = -1 )
virtual

◆ writeItem() [5/20]

virtual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
AcGePoint3d const & ,
int = -1 )
virtual

◆ writeItem() [6/20]

virtual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
AcGeScale3d const & ,
int = -1 )
virtual

◆ writeItem() [7/20]

virtual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
AcGeVector2d const & ,
int = -1 )
virtual

◆ writeItem() [8/20]

virtual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
AcGeVector3d const & ,
int = -1 )
virtual

◆ writeItem() [9/20]

virtual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
ACHAR const *  )
virtual

◆ writeItem() [10/20]

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
Adesk::Int32  )

◆ writeItem() [11/20]

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
Adesk::Int8  )

◆ writeItem() [12/20]

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
Adesk::UInt16  )

◆ writeItem() [13/20]

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
Adesk::UInt8  )

◆ writeItem() [14/20]

virtual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
ads_binary const &  )
virtual

◆ writeItem() [15/20]

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
bool  )

◆ writeItem() [16/20]

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
const AcDbHandle &  )

◆ writeItem() [17/20]

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
const AcString &  )

◆ writeItem() [18/20]

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
double ,
int = -1 )

◆ writeItem() [19/20]

virtual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
int  )
virtual

◆ writeItem() [20/20]

virtual Acad::ErrorStatus AcDbDxfFiler::writeItem ( int ,
unsigned long  )
virtual

◆ writeObjectId()

virtual Acad::ErrorStatus AcDbDxfFiler::writeObjectId ( int ,
const AcDbObjectId &  )
virtual

◆ writePoint2d()

virtual Acad::ErrorStatus AcDbDxfFiler::writePoint2d ( int ,
const AcGePoint2d & ,
int = -1 )
virtual

◆ writePoint3d()

virtual Acad::ErrorStatus AcDbDxfFiler::writePoint3d ( int ,
const AcGePoint3d & ,
int = -1 )
virtual

◆ writeResBuf()

virtual Acad::ErrorStatus AcDbDxfFiler::writeResBuf ( resbuf const & )
virtual

◆ writeScale3d()

virtual Acad::ErrorStatus AcDbDxfFiler::writeScale3d ( int ,
const AcGeScale3d & ,
int = -1 )
virtual

◆ writeString() [1/2]

virtual Acad::ErrorStatus AcDbDxfFiler::writeString ( int ,
ACHAR const *  )
virtual

◆ writeString() [2/2]

virtual Acad::ErrorStatus AcDbDxfFiler::writeString ( int ,
const AcString &  )
virtual

◆ writeUInt16()

virtual Acad::ErrorStatus AcDbDxfFiler::writeUInt16 ( int ,
Adesk::UInt16  )
virtual

◆ writeUInt32()

virtual Acad::ErrorStatus AcDbDxfFiler::writeUInt32 ( int ,
Adesk::UInt32 const &  )
virtual

◆ writeUInt64()

virtual Acad::ErrorStatus AcDbDxfFiler::writeUInt64 ( int ,
Adesk::UInt64 const &  )
virtual

◆ writeUInt8()

virtual Acad::ErrorStatus AcDbDxfFiler::writeUInt8 ( int ,
Adesk::UInt8  )
virtual

◆ writeVector2d()

virtual Acad::ErrorStatus AcDbDxfFiler::writeVector2d ( int ,
const AcGeVector2d & ,
int = -1 )
virtual

◆ writeVector3d()

virtual Acad::ErrorStatus AcDbDxfFiler::writeVector3d ( int ,
const AcGeVector3d & ,
int = -1 )
virtual

◆ writeXDataStart()

virtual Acad::ErrorStatus AcDbDxfFiler::writeXDataStart ( void )
virtual

The documentation for this class was generated from the following file: